THE 4 WHEELS OF BÖN

Pönlop Tsangpa Tenzin Rinpoche will teach about The Four Wheels of Bön which is a teaching from Buddha Tonpa Shenrab Miwo, the founder of bön. It’s one fundamental texts of the Dzogchen tradition of the Yungdrung Bön. This teaching will be meant for long-time practitioners as well as for beginners. It was already taught in France some years ago by Yongdzin Rinpoche.

 

Pönlop Tsangpa Tenzin Rinpoche is the head teacher of The Bön Dialectic School of Triten Norbustse Monastery, and he is also very appreciated by the western students for his cheerful and simple way of explaining complex topics. We are delighted that he’s coming to teach us in Paris.

INTRODUCTION TO DZOGCHEN MEDITATION

We are excited to announce that Khenchen Tenpa Yungdrung Rinpoche will be coming back to

Esodus, NY for another Dzogchen Meditation Retreat in May 2024. The teaching and practices will

focus on the Bönpo Dzogchen Preliminaries that are critical for the introduction of Dzogchen meditation,

specifically:

• Zhine – Calm Abiding, and

• Rushen (Khorde Rushen Yewa) – Distinguishing of Samsara and Nirvana.

All levels of practitioners interested in Dzogchen meditation are welcome!
